According to a recent report from Yahoo Finance, Leopold Aschenbrenner has expressed a bearish view on Galaxy Digital. Aschenbrenner, who gained prominence as a former global macro strategist, is known for his contrarian positions and detailed analysis of market cycles. While the report does not detail the specific reasoning behind his stance, market observers note that Galaxy Digital’s performance is closely tied to the price movements of major c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um. The firm, led by CEO Mike Novogratz, provides a range of services including asset management, trading, and advisory for digital assets. Its stock has historically shown high correlation with crypto market trends, making it sensitive to both rapid upswings and sharp corrections. The bearish sentiment from a respected macro investor could add to the caution already surrounding the sector amid ongoing regulatory scrutiny in the United States and elsewhere.

Given his track record, his views might prompt other institutional investors to reassess their positions in Galaxy Digital and similar crypto‑exposed equities. The firm’s recent earnings reports have reflected the volatility of digital asset markets, with revenues and net income fluctuating in line with crypto prices. Additionally, regulatory uncertainty—ranging from SEC enforcement actions to proposed legislation on stablecoins and crypto lending—remains a headwind for Galaxy Digital’s business model. Aschenbrenner’s stance could therefore signal that he expects these challenges to persist or intensify in the near term.
